Dear UK Border Agency,

Please provide the following information regarding your
responsibilities under the Data Protection Act (DPA):

1. How many requests do you get under the DPA each year?
2. How do you verify the authenticity of DPA requests?
3. Do you conduct regular DPA audits / have an auditing policy?
4. Do you maintain data on errors in information covered by the
DPA?
a. If so, please provide data for the past 5 years.

Yours faithfully,

Marie Griffiths

Dear Marie Griffiths

RE: Freedom of Information request 14264.

Thank you for your email received on 5th March 2010 where you have
requested information about the number of Data Protection Act requests the
UK Border Agency receives each year for the last 5 years. This falls to be
dealt with under the Freedom of Information Act 2000.

Section 1(3) of the Freedom of Information Act provides that a public
authority need not comply with a request for information unless any
further information reasonably required to identify and locate the
information is supplied. I am unclear about the exact scope of the
information in which you are interested. To ensure that we provide you
with the right information, please could you clarify your request, so that
we can process your request. Can you confirm you are requesting
information relating to the number of Subject Access Requests received by
the UK Border Agency under section 7 of the Data Protection Act?

When you provide this information we will aim to send you a full response
to your request within twenty working days of its receipt. I look forward
to hearing from you shortly. However, please note that if I do not receive
appropriate clarification of your request within two months from the date
of this letter, I will consider this request to be closed.
